Pros

Some coworkers were supportive and helpful despite the company's poor handling of pay and employee concerns.

Cons

I would strongly advise anyone considering this company to think twice. Long story short, pay grades changed, and despite still performing the work for the higher pay grade, I was never moved to the correct level. When I raised the issue, I was met with constant runarounds and conflicting explanations. When I escalated the matter to Employee Relations, they relied on information from a supervisor who wasn’t even with the company at the time and essentially dismissed my concerns. They also refused to provide any written correspondence, insisting on only discussing the issue over the phone—seemingly to avoid accountability. For two years, I was underpaid, and despite multiple attempts to resolve it, the issue remains unresolved. If fair compensation and transparency matter to you, I’d recommend looking elsewhere.
